Debt restructuring might be just one of many choices directors of companies in monetary distress will need to contemplate. Directors need to consider what is true for his or her company, having regard to their numerous statutory and customary regulation duties, as each company’s circumstances will dictate what is suitable. The opposite essential options are consensual restructuring, voluntary administration or creditors’ voluntary liquidation (which can incorporate the simplified course of to be available for eligible firms below the reforms).

The Supreme Courtroom noticed that in cases of financial debt, even when the NCLT is satisfied of a debt and a default, it has discretion to reject the petition for other reasons. Section 7 of the IBC uses the phrase 'may' and not 'shall'; solvent firms should not be penalised for quickly defaulting in repayment of their debts.

Set-off is enforceable in insolvency proceedings to the same extent that it's enforceable beneath non-bankruptcy legislation (ie, contractual and customary law setoff is obtainable). 4.10 Can transactions entered into by the debtor previous to be insolvency be challenged and set aside? What are the relevant grounds / look-back durations / defences? Yes, pre-insolvency transactions can be challenged and set aside on various grounds together with preference, fraudulent switch and the trustee's 'robust-arm' powers. Preferences are pre-bankruptcy transfers that allow creditors to receive more than their professional rata share.
